Side impact sensor



Side impact sensor (left and right) is set in the middle of the passenger compartment in the side-impact airbags. SRS-ECU undermines the right pillow or seat belt pretensioners. The decision on the activation of a particular side airbag is made based on the sensor signals the side strokes.
SRS-ECU supports side airbags, comparing the acceleration recorded auxiliary sensors.
Signal processing auxiliary sensors pass the time.

NOTE
Ignition Avoid applying sharp blows to the body in the area of the sensors. SRS-ECU can take it for collision and undermine the airbag.
